Detailed Engineering Specifications

Designed for demanding industrial environments, this Titanium Grade 5 (Ti-6Al-4V) stock sheet measures 0.118 inches in thickness, 35 inches in length, and 35 inches in width. Exhibiting a minimum tensile strength of 130 ksi and yield strength of 120 ksi, its excellent biocompatibility and superior corrosion resistance make it suitable for aerospace, medical implants, and high-performance marine applications where material integrity is paramount.

Common Mistakes & How to Avoid Them

❌ Mistake✅ Correct Approach
Using standard steel cutting tools, leading to tool wear and poor cut quality.Employ specialized carbide or diamond-tipped tooling designed for titanium to maintain precision and tool longevity.
Inadequate shielding gas during welding, resulting in embrittlement and reduced weld strength.Maintain a strict inert gas atmosphere (argon or helium) throughout the welding process to prevent atmospheric contamination.

⚠️ Engineering Warnings

  • Titanium dust is combustible; take precautions against ignition sources.
  • Avoid contact with strong oxidizing acids at elevated temperatures.
